Many of us have been there when that first date with a potential partner runs a little dry. The nerves are naturally high during a first meeting and good conversation is key to securing a second date. You're enjoying the company of your date and feel (or hoping) that they feel the same too.

But then suddenly the words don't come as easy and you begin to sweat over what to say next, something genuine that doesn't sound silly. Luckily, one therapist is trying his 'best to save your relationship' with a series of TikTok videos packed with helpful romance tips.

Jeff Guenther, a licensed professional counsellor from Portland, Oregon, posted one particular video designed to assist anyone on a first date. The one-minute video, called '5 first date questions that reveal important information', lists a series of conversation starters that he believes will keep the date flowing well. Below are the details of each question along with Jeff's reason for asking them.

What are you most passionate about?

Jeff said, as he sits on video dressed casually in a blue hoodie: “This question helps you understand their priorities, interests and what truly excites them. Or, it can trigger a mini existential crisis about how meaningless and empty their lives are.”

Who is the most influential person in your life and why?

He continued: “This question can reveal their values as well as the type of people they admire and look up to. Do they exclusively list cancelled male comedians? Great info to have.”

What book, movie or TV show has had the biggest impact on your life?

He went on: “This can help you understand their taste in entertainment, the types of stories that resonate with them and most importantly what TV show they routinely falls asleep to every night. Personally? I’m a 'New Girl' kinda guy.”

What’s your favourite childhood memory?

Jeff, who has 2.8 million TikTok followers, said: “This can provide insights into their upbringing, family dynamics and the experiences that shape them and fun teasers about the unresolved trauma that could manifest in a future relationship.”

Do you have any unusual or quirky habits?

He finished off by saying: “This can provide insight into their personality and help you discover unique traits that make them who they are. As well as super f***ing annoying s**t they love to do that you’ll want to fully consider if you’re thinking about giving them a second date.”

The video has been viewed more than 37,000 times and has received hundreds of comments of vary responses. One user said: "Just when I couldn’t love you more, I learn you’re a New Girl guy," while someone else added: "I’m literally on my way to a first date right now and I came to your page to get questions and wow! You just posted this, thank you."

However, one of Jeff's followers admitted: "I love you but, I would feel so uncomfortable asking these questions and answering them. Talk about being put on the spot. I like authentic organic chat." Another was left unimpressed by the tips and likened the questions to a job interview: "If someone asks me these questions on a date like I’m in a job interview, I’m just getting up and walking out."
